Audi produced the second Q8 concept, which you can see here, with the first one being introduced at the previous Detroit Motor Show. This is a mild hybrid sporty SUV and it has been presented at the Geneva Motor Show, one of the most important car shows in the world.

The 2017 Audi Q8 Sport concept is equipped with a mild hybrid drivetrain that delivers 469 hp and 516 lb-ft of torque, while the car can go from 0 to 62 mph in 4.7 seconds. The limited top speed of this concept is pretty solid 170 mph or 275 km/h. The hybrid drivetrain consists of a 3.0-liter V6 TFSI that produces 443 horses and an electric motor which adds 27 hp. In addition, there is a 48-volt electrical system which is in charge of electricity flow.

The Q8 Sport concept also features a lithium-ion battery pack which lies underneath the luggage compartment and it can provide a decent amount of power to steer the car through congested traffic, while electric power can be used for parking and maneuvering the car as well. With an 85-liter fuel tank, the overall range of this concept is 746 miles.

Audi decided to improve the engine by adding the electric compressor which was seen in the Audi SQ7 diesel for the first time. The purpose of this compressor is to add more horsepower and allow a lag-free acceleration any time you want. The engine is combined with an eight-speed automatic transmission while the concept has a 4WD configuration.

The Audi Management Board Chairman, Rupert Stadler declared: “The drive system of the 2017 Audi Q8 Sport concept is a major step towards optimizing efficiency and sustainability in large-volume series production. The combination of mild hybrid technology and a TFSI engine sets a new benchmark for the synthesis of electromobility and combustion engines.”

The mild-hybrid powertrain will definitely appear in some upcoming Audi models such as the A6, A7, A8 and the Q7 is supposed to get this powertrain as well. The production variant of the Audi Q8 will go on sale sometime next year.

Audi installed several digital displays inside, while there is the version of the 12.3-inch Virtual Cockpit with higher-resolution. Furthermore, the driver will read information which will be projected on the windshield from the cutting-edge “contact-analogue” head-up display. The Q8 sits on 23-inch alloy wheels around which are 305/35 tires. What is fascinating is that there are 20-inch ceramic disc brakes and the concept allows five levels of ground clearance with the 90mm height difference between the levels.
